| declare_parameters(ParameterHandler &prm) | aspect::Plugins::InterfaceBase | static |
| get_data_size() const | aspect::Particle::Integrator::Interface< dim > | virtual |
| get_particle_manager_index() const | aspect::Particle::ParticleInterfaceBase | |
| initialize() | aspect::Plugins::InterfaceBase | virtual |
| load(const std::map< std::string, std::string > &status_strings) | aspect::Plugins::InterfaceBase | virtual |
| local_integrate_step(const typename ParticleHandler< dim >::particle_iterator &begin_particle, const typename ParticleHandler< dim >::particle_iterator &end_particle, const std::vector< Tensor< 1, dim >> &old_velocities, const std::vector< Tensor< 1, dim >> &velocities, const double dt)=0 | aspect::Particle::Integrator::Interface< dim > | pure virtual |
| new_integration_step() | aspect::Particle::Integrator::Interface< dim > | virtual |
| parse_parameters(ParameterHandler &prm) | aspect::Plugins::InterfaceBase | virtual |
| ParticleInterfaceBase() | aspect::Particle::ParticleInterfaceBase | |
| read_data(const typename ParticleHandler< dim >::particle_iterator &particle, const void *data) | aspect::Particle::Integrator::Interface< dim > | virtual |
| required_solution_vectors() const =0 | aspect::Particle::Integrator::Interface< dim > | pure virtual |
| save(std::map< std::string, std::string > &status_strings) const | aspect::Plugins::InterfaceBase | virtual |
| set_particle_manager_index(unsigned int particle_manager_index) | aspect::Particle::ParticleInterfaceBase | |
| update() | aspect::Plugins::InterfaceBase | virtual |
| write_data(const typename ParticleHandler< dim >::particle_iterator &particle, void *data) const | aspect::Particle::Integrator::Interface< dim > | virtual |
| ~InterfaceBase()=default | aspect::Plugins::InterfaceBase | virtual |